Call for Papers for the Column "The Holocene: The Historical Background of the Anthropocene"

      The Anthropocene is a crucial period during which human activities have altered some of the boundary conditions of the Earth system, marking that the Earth may have entered a new geological era. The environmental effects of human activities are a long-term development process. Therefore, revealing the historical background of the Anthropocene is a prerequisite for clarifying the debate on the starting time of the Anthropocene. China has a long history and a large population, and there are significant spatial and temporal differences in human activities and their environmental effects, which urgently require in-depth and systematic comprehensive analysis and research to explore the connotation of the human-land relationship.

I. Scope of Papers for the Column (Including but Not Limited to)

      This column aims to, on the basis of a comprehensive analysis of the Holocene climate change records and the historical background of global warming, systematically summarize the historical process of human activities in the Holocene in China and their interactions with environmental changes. By combining archaeological data, historical document records, environmental archaeological evidence, geological and biological records, etc., it clarifies the consistencies and particularities of the characteristics of climate change in the Anthropocene compared with the Holocene climate background, analyzes the evolution process of the impact of human activities in the Holocene in China on the environment, and evaluates the degree and scope of the transformation of the environment by human forces during key periods, in order to provide key clues and scientific basis for the historical background of the Anthropocene.
